About F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und (TLTD) Seasonality
F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und (TLTD) has been analyzed using 14 years of historical data to identify seasonal patterns. Classified under ETFs, F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und shows distinct seasonal tendencies based on historical data.
The strongest month for F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und is historically April, with an average return of 2.46% and a win rate of 86%. Conversely, June tends to be the weakest month, averaging -2.11% return.
Looking at the full calendar year, F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und has an average annual return of 4.91% with an overall monthly win rate of 58.1%. Out of 12 months, 7 typically show positive average returns.
The seasonal pattern for FlexShares Morningstar Developed Markets ex-US Factor Tilt Index Fund has a consistency score of 47 (Poor), based on 15 years of data. Higher consistency means the seasonal pattern has been more reliable across different market conditions.
